The federal government established the Employee Retention Credit (ERC) to offer a refundable work tax credit to assist services with the price of maintaining staff employed.
Qualified services that experienced a decrease in gross receipts or were closed due to government order as well as didn’t claim the credit when they submitted their initial return can take advantage by filing adjusted work tax returns. Companies that file quarterly work tax returns can file Form 941-X, Adjusted Employer’s Quarterly Federal Tax Return or Claim for RefundPDF, to claim the credit for previous 2020 and 2021 quarters. How to report employee retention credit on tax return.
With the exception of a recovery start up business, most taxpayers came to be ineligible to claim the ERC for salaries paid after September 30, 2021. How to report employee retention credit on tax return. A recovery start-up business can still claim the ERC for salaries paid after June 30, 2021, as well as prior to January 1, 2022. Eligible employers might still claim the ERC for prior quarters by submitting an appropriate modified work tax return within the deadline set forth in the corresponding kind directions. How to report employee retention credit on tax return. If an company files a Form 941, the employer still has time to file an modified return within the time set forth under the “Is There a Deadline for Filing Form 941-X?” section in Form 941-X, Adjusted Employer’s Quarterly Federal Tax Return or Claim for Refund.

What Are Qualified Wages?
What counts as qualified incomes depends on the dimension of your business and the number of employees you have on personnel. There’s no dimension limitation to be qualified for the ERC, yet small and also huge companies are treated differently.
For 2020, if you had more than 100 full-time workers in 2019, you can only claim the incomes of employees you kept but were not working. If you have less than 100 staff members, you can claim every person, whether they were functioning or otherwise.
For 2021, the limit was elevated to having 500 permanent staff members in 2019, offering companies a great deal more freedom as to who they can claim for the credit. How to report employee retention credit on tax return. Any kind of wages that are based on FICA taxes Qualify, and you can consist of qualified health and wellness costs when determining the tax credit.
This revenue has to have been paid in between March 13, 2020, as well as September 30, 2021. Nevertheless, recovery start-up organizations need to claim the credit through the end of 2021.
